LAS VEGAS (AP) -- A Milwaukee woman has surrendered to police to face murder and prostitution charges after she was accused of fatally stabbing another woman in a Las Vegas Strip hotel lobby.
Police say 23-year-old Latrovia Reed was being held without bail at the Clark County jail awaiting an initial appearance in Las Vegas Justice Court in the deadly 6 a.m. Friday attack.
She is accused of pulling a knife and stabbing a 22-year-old Milwaukee woman just inside the valet entrance at Bally's hotel-casino.
The victim was pronounced dead minutes later at Sunrise Hospital and Medical Center.
The Clark County coroner's office is withholding the dead woman's name pending notification of family members.
